I was due to run the Jigsaw 10k this morning - a very local, very flat, fast 10k course on an old airfield. Having worked on my speed a little recently, I was hoping to run a decent time. Sadly, for reasons I don't fully understand๐Ÿ˜ฎ, my anxiety (which has been so much better since I took up running) kicked in big time last night and I tossed and turned worrying about the race. No idea why; I run the distance once a week (and further!) , preparation has been good, the race is local. Anyway, to cut a long story short, I bottled it!๐Ÿ˜”โ˜บ๏ธ To reassure myself I am not a complete failure, I went out for a10k on the trails this morning instead. I chose a flattish route and just went for it, trying to keep a decent pace. The cooler weather is definately suiting me and as Garmin bleeped away I could see I was on for a good time. End result - 58:18 and although not a PB, one of my fastest 10k runs. In fact it is a couple of years since I have run under an hour, so what was a rubbish start to the day has ended up feeling a little brighter! I guess every cloud has a silver lining!๐Ÿ™‚
